POSITION SUMMARY
The Machine Operator (CNC Operator) is responsible for producing all programs for CNC and are created to optimize machine output and efficiency. Also operating as a backup for work order processing for manufacturing, with all required documentation printed and assembled, both in printed and electronic form. You will be producing CNC programs, routings, material info, layup info, cutting lists, drawings and other information needed for manufacturing. All information must be compiled and checked for accuracy to ensure correct and complete manufacturing.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
Optimizing CNCs using software programs, ensuring efficiency
Creating CNC programs using the following programs; Mastercam, Holzher HOPS, Holtzher Betternest
Create material information/documentation, such as lay-up lists, and cutting lists through the Holzher (or Ardis) optimizing software
Validate enough material was ordered (from BOM). Report on Shortages or overages to Production QA and Production Manager immediately for decision/direction
Compile the FINAL drawing set for each Batch/Work Order submitted to the plant, ensuring all previous copies have been removed from the plant floor AND that the online version has been updated accordingly. This package includes:
Work Order cover page that shows the routings
Material list(s) for production
Colour schedule
Hardware schedule
Other documentation required to successfully manufacture without error or deviation from drawing
Communicate clearly with all Plant/Engineering stakeholders to promote accurate, timely and complete manufacture of products. Return feedback provided to Production QA and Production Manager for action.
Provide Production QA regular feedback to ensure continuous improvement can be attained/maintained, with the objective of eliminating rework of drawings
Update status and progress on the applicable Smartsheets in real-time, ensuring 100% accuracy
Ensure total and consistent accuracy of the documentation (instructions) produced
